Bill Oddie brings his infectious enthusiasm and inimitable style to this comprehensive introduction for the birdwatching beginner. Starting with the basics, the book goes on to explore all aspects of this increasingly popular pastime, from choosing a field guide, to easy identification tips, basic field techniques and avoiding common errors. The book is expertly written by one of Britain's most popular birding celebrities. With vital additional information on bird behaviour, bird reserves and conservation, as well as practical advice on how to take your interest further afield, this should be an indispensable guide for the beginner and enthusiast alike.
